When an Azerbaijani soldier’s weapon jams during a familiarization course with a U.S.-issued service rifle, Lance Cpl. Nathan E. Gibson, infantryman and native of Chickamauga, Ga., Black Sea Rotational Force 11, demonstrates the remedial-action procedures for clearing the weapon and getting back to the fight. Marines from Black Sea Rotational Force 11 trained with Azerbaijan’s Operational Capabilities and Concepts Battalion in close-quarters, combat marksmanship to build proficiency and develop interoperability in counterinsurgency and peacekeeping operations in a combined-forces environment. The Azerbaijani troops mark the fourth cycle of partner nations from the Black Sea, Balkan and Caucasus regions to train in the Babadag Training Area since April.
